Core Mechanisms: How It Works

The cremation process begins the moment death is confirmed, but the clock doesn’t start ticking until **legal and medical requirements are met**. The first critical step is obtaining the **death certificate**, which can take **24 to 48 hours** if the death occurs in a hospital or **several days** if it’s unexpected (e.g., at home or in a nursing facility). Once the certificate is issued, the body is transported to the funeral home, where it may undergo **embalming (if requested)**, which adds **1 to 3 days** to the timeline. For **direct cremations**, embalming is skipped, cutting days off the process. The actual cremation involves **three primary phases**: 1. **Preparation**: The body is placed in a **cremation container** (often a cardboard or wooden box) and identified with a **metal tag** containing the deceased’s name and date of birth. 2. **Cremation**: The container is inserted into a **high-temperature furnace (1,400–1,800°F / 760–980°C)**, where it remains for **90 to 150 minutes**. The process reduces the body to **bone fragments**, which are then processed into ashes. 3. **Cooling and Processing**: The remains must cool for **at least 15 minutes** before they can be removed. A **processing machine** (like a cremulator) grinds the bones into a fine powder, taking **10 to 20 minutes**. The ashes are then weighed, placed in an urn, and returned to the family. Each of these steps has built-in delays—**legal holds, furnace scheduling, and processing backlogs**—that contribute to the **total time it takes to get cremated**. Comparative Analysis

Factor Cremation Traditional Burial
Timeline from Death to Finalization **24–72 hours (direct) to 5–7 days (with service)** **3–5 days (viewing) to 1+ week (burial + service)**
Cost $1,000–$3,000 (direct) / $3,000–$6,000 (with service) $5,000–$12,000+ (including plot, casket, embalming)
Environmental Impact **Moderate (emissions from furnace, mercury concerns)** **High (land use, embalming chemicals, concrete vaults)**
Personalization Options **High (urns, scattering, memorial jewelry, digital memorials)** **Moderate (headstones, grave markers, cemetery plots)**

Future Trends and Innovations

The cremation industry is on the cusp of **major technological and ethical transformations**, all of which will influence **how long does it take to get cremated** in the coming decades. One of the most promising advancements is **water cremation (alkaline hydrolysis)**, a process that uses **water and alkali to dissolve the body** in **4–6 hours**, reducing the timeline significantly while producing **sterile, liquid remains** that can be buried or scattered. This method is already gaining traction in **Canada, the UK, and parts of the U.S.**, where it’s seen as a **faster, greener alternative** to flame cremation.
